diff options
-rw-r--r-- | lib/Target/ARM/AsmParser/ARMAsmParser.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/Target/ARM/AsmParser/ARMAsmParser.cpp b/lib/Target/ARM/AsmParser/ARMAsmParser.cpp index 65f0ad4bb5..e00ced265e 100644 --- a/lib/Target/ARM/AsmParser/ARMAsmParser.cpp +++ b/lib/Target/ARM/AsmParser/ARMAsmParser.cpp @@ -382,10 +382,10 @@ void ARMOperand::dump(raw_ostream &OS) const { getImm()->print(OS); break; case Memory: - OS << "<memory>"; + OS << "<memory" << (!Mem.Writeback ? ">" : "!>"); break; case Register: - OS << "<register " << getReg() << ">"; + OS << "<register " << getReg() << (!Reg.Writeback ? ">" : "!>"); break; case RegisterList: { OS << "<register_list "; |